To: Heads of Department, Hadleigh Furnishings

The Larkspur modular shelving line launches at the start of next quarter. Production at the Westmere plant is on schedule, with initial inventory covering eight weeks of forecast demand. Pricing is finalized; marketing assets ship to regional teams in two weeks. Customer service scripts and returns handling procedures are in final review. Each department should confirm readiness at Monday's sync. The confidential positioning statement guiding our messaging appears directly below.

internal memo for yahag-tahog: The pricing group signed off on a budget of $152.8 million for Project Soriel.

### Step 6 — Import relevance tuning notes

Welcome aboard. This step migrates the historical relevance tuning notes for Quillfind into the new annotations schema. Run migration 0117, then the importer, which validates each note against the query-log snapshot and flags mismatches for manual review. Expect roughly ten minutes. The importer connects to the annotations database using the connection string below.

replica DSN, kajep-yahag: mssql://praok_svc:iF@db-8d68.plorvaio.local:5432/eliion

## Deploying the Gatewick Proctor Queue

Deploys are pretty painless: push to main, wait for the pipeline, then watch the queue drain dashboard for five minutes. If candidates pile up mid-exam, roll back first and ask questions later — the queue replays safely. Everything the workers care about lives in one config block, shown here for reference.

settings of bafof-yagef:
JOROX_PIN=8740
JOROX_TENANT=pelox
JOROX_METRICS_HOST=metrics.jorox.qorvelworks.internal
JOROX_SEAL=seal_c78f63c1
JOROX_STANDBY_TEAM=norax